  • Abstract
    In this paper we study the coupling mechanism between the conduction electrons and the allowed spin wave modes of a micron size system. To achieve this goal we investigate the variation of the giant magneto resistance (GMR) effect in a single spin valve sensor as a function of the spin wave mode excited in the system. We couple ferromagnetic resonance technique on a single sensor with transport measurements to probe at the same time the spin dynamics of the magnetic multilayer and his GMR response.
